Technology

My kids and their generation take technology for granted. They panic is they don't have their mobile phones with them !  If only they knew how we coped.
When I was their age it was so different.  The house phone was in the hall at the bottom of the stair, so no privacy.  There were no mobiles, internet, computers or freeview television.
We used our imagination and made our own entertainment and still had a great time.  People talked to each other, the art of conversation.  It saddens me to see friends out for a coffee but everyone is on their mobile texting or playing games and not interacting with the rest of their group!
If I needed to send a letter, I would sit down, get out my pen and writing pad and manually write a letter, put it in an envelope with a stamp and post it in a letter box. Now a days its an email or text.  It doesn't feel personal at all.  I love receiving a hand written letter.
I've heard that my kids are the generation of the future, bright, intelligent and forward looking.  They have internet, Facebook, Twitter, Instagram, and so much more.
So when I hear my kids saying that they are bored, I am amazed that they could even feel that way with so much entertainment to hand!  DS, Xbox, Playstation etc
What would they do with a power cut or loss of interest ? 
We have many board games in the house and they are a joy to play, I love hearing my kids laughing and chatting around the table as we play.
So in this age of technology, are we really moving forward ?  I feel that is debatable
Kids can appear to be isolated and in their own worlds with all the contents of the screens streaming  alien lands and far off battles. Much more interesting than this world !

Technology ... constantly changing, developing and upgrading !
